Population Overview

Bear Lake has a population of 280, which is below the state average. This suggests a smaller and more localized community environment.

Income and Economy

The median household income in Bear Lake is $68,000, which is below the state average, indicating moderate economic conditions.

Housing Market

The average housing price in Bear Lake is about $265,000, making it relatively affordable compared to many cities in Michigan.

Employment and Safety

The unemployment rate in Bear Lake is 5.20%, slightly above the state average, suggesting moderate employment conditions. Crime rates in Bear Lake are higher than the state average, which may be a factor for residents to consider.
